Chinese box office revenue on New Years Day hit a new record as moviegoers flocked to cinemas on the mainland. China’s containment of COVID-19 within its borders has allowed cinemas and other entertainment venues to operate across the country.

China movie ticket sales hit $ 92 million on January 1 according to at the Maoyan ticketing platform. The previous New Year’s earnings record in China was $ 55 million on Jan. 1, 2018, nearly half the amount earned this year.

China reopened its economy earlier than most other countries in the world after successfully quelling the transmission of COVID-19, making it one of the few places in the world where new films can premiere in theaters with in-person audiences and movie studios can rake in box office revenue.

Open theaters helped China overtake the United States to become the world’s largest movie market last year, despite its box office revenue drop from $ 9.1 billion in 2019 to $ 2.8 billion in 2020, thanks to cinema stops at the start of the pandemic. Total box office revenue for the United States in 2020 was $ 2.1 billion.

Chinese movie The eight hundred, which was released in August, grossed $ 461 million at the global box office, making it the highest grossing film of 2020, according to to the Box Office Mojo ticket tracking website. It is the first Chinese film to reach the top spot at the global box office.

Two national films released on December 31 A small red flower and Warm hug, won the No. 1 and No. 2 places respectively at the Chinese box office for January 1, followed by a Hong Kong film titled Shock wave 2 at n ° 3. The animated film by Disney and Pixar, Soul, came fifth.

Just over a year ago, cinemas in China closed as the coronavirus began to spread. Some started to reopen in late March 2020, but ticket sales were slow, so China’s National Film Bureau reversed the decision a few days later, closing theaters until July 20. Most cinemas have started reopening on this summer date and have remained open ever since.

In the United States, by contrast, most theaters are still closed and blockbuster Hollywood productions like Black Widow and Wonder Woman 1984 postponed their releases from 2020 to 2021 or were created on streaming platforms rather than in theaters to account for theatrical closures.

The takeover of Chinese cinemas in 2020 accelerated the already growing importance from Chinese box office to Hollywood movies.

Produced in the United States Soul, for example, premiered on the Disney + streaming platform for US viewers, but premiered in theaters in 10 countries, including China, where won $ 5.5 million of its $ 7.6 million in opening weekend box office revenue.
